After a fairly rough ferry crossing, we made it home safely on the afternoon of Thursday 21st December, 58 days after leaving. We're tired, but very happy that we've completed this amazing trip without any major issues.


It's a lot to look back on and it's going to take some time to digest everything that we saw and experienced along the way. In the meantime, Christmas is only a few days away and we have to start finalising the details for our second epic trip, 7 weeks in Vietnam and Cambodia from mid-January.


Thanks for following along with our trip, we hope you enjoyed the photos! For any nerds who are interested, below are some stats and info about the trip.



Total nights: 57

  • France - 28

  • Germany - 17

  • Poland - 4

  • Czechia - 3

  • Spain - 2

  • At sea - 2

  • Belgium - 1

  • Switzerland - 0 (lunch stop only)

  • Netherlands - 0 (lunch stop only)


Number of different accommodations: 27

  • France - 10

  • Germany - 9

  • Poland - 2

  • Czechia - 2

  • At sea - 2

  • Spain - 1

  • Belgium - 1


Best accommodations:

  • Essen - nicest hotel

  • Cremieu - nicest apartment


Worst accommodations:

  • Olomouc - dingy room, rough area

  • Polish/German border - crappy motel with zero sound-proofing and noisy guests, plus awful dining options

  • Special mention to Rothenburg hotel - nice big comfortable room but with the worst bathroom ever (tiny and smelly)


Total distance driven: 7359.7km (4573.1 miles)


Longest drive by distance: 443km (San Sebastian to Carcassonne, 4.5 hours)


Longest drive by time: 5.5 hours (Pilsen to Olomouc, 347km, sleet, fog, roadworks, multiple crashes)


Christmas markets visited: 15

Castles/Palaces/Citadels: 9

Sports events attended by Mark: 5 (rugby league, rugby union, football x 2, ice hockey)

Towers climbed by Mark: 5

Funiculars/rack and pinion rail: 3

Ferris wheels: 3

Hedge mazes: 2


Max daytime temperature: 23 degrees

Min daytime temperature: -8 degrees


Max elevation: 1465m (Puy de Dôme)

Min elevation: -135m (Wieliczka salt mine)

Costs

Diesel: €797.20

Tolls: €236.95 (incl. €13 for Czech vignette)

Parking: €228.50

Emissions stickers (France and Germany): €18.30


Cheapest accommodation: €39

Most expensive accommodation: €88


Cost of ferries: €836

Cost of local transportation: €244.70

Cost of sightseeing/entry fees: €472.80
